preventDefault()方法
preventDefault()方法是JavaScript中的一个阻止默认事件的方法,它可以阻止浏览器的默认行为,比如表单提交、页面跳转等。
使用preventDefault()方法的方法很简单,只需要在事件处理函数中调用它即可,比如:
document.getElementById("myForm").addEventListener("submit", function(event){ event.preventDefault(); });
上面的代码中,我们为表单元素myForm添加了submit事件的监听器,在事件处理函数中调用了event.preventDefault()方法,从而阻止了表单提交的默认行为。
preventDefault()方法还可以用于阻止键盘快捷键的默认行为,比如:
document.addEventListener("keydown", function (event) { if (event.keyCode === 13) { event.preventDefault(); } });
上面的代码中,我们为document元素添加了keydown事件的监听器,当用户按下回车键时,调用event.preventDefault()方法,阻止了键盘快捷键的默认行为。
preventDefault()方法是一个非常实用的方法,它可以用来阻止浏览器的默认行为,从而更好地控制用户的交互体验。